As a policy, reporters will certainly not make use of a lengthy word when a brief one will do. They make use of subject-verb-object construction and brilliant, energetic prose (see Grammar). They supply stories, instances and allegories, and they rarely rely on generalizations or abstract ideas. Information writers attempt to prevent using the same word greater than when in a paragraph (sometimes called an "echo" or "word mirror").


Headlines often leave out the topic (e.g., "Jumps From Watercraft, Catches in Wheel") or verb (e.g., "Pet cat woman fortunate"). Post leads are in some cases categorized right into tough leads and soft leads. A hard lead aims to offer a detailed thesis which informs the viewers what the short article will cover.

Usual use is that one or 2 sentences each create their own paragraph. Journalists usually describe the organization or framework of a newspaper article as an inverted pyramid. The important and most intriguing components of a tale are placed at the start, with supporting information following in order of diminishing relevance.


It enables people to check out a topic to only the depth that their inquisitiveness takes them, and without the imposition of information or subtleties that they could think about irrelevant, but still making that information offered to more interested visitors. The upside down pyramid structure likewise makes it possible for posts to be trimmed to any kind of arbitrary size during format, to suit the space available.
